The journey begins early in Hanoi, with pickup between 7:45 and 8:30 am. The transfer to Tuan Chau Island by private vehicle or group bus is straightforward, taking about 3-4 hours. This part of the trip is crucial—you’ll want to ensure your pick-up is punctual so you can maximize your time on the water. The cruise’s logistics seem seamless, with staff welcoming guests at Tuan Chau Marina and guiding everyone through check-in in a relaxed lounge setting.
Boarding the Legend Cruise, you’re greeted with a refreshing drink and cold towel, a simple but appreciated gesture. The boat itself is described as luxurious, and the onboard restaurant serves a hearty lunch while cruising toward Sung Sot Cave—one of the largest and most breathtaking caves in Halong Bay. The cave features impressive stalactites and stalagmites, with some formations that are truly unique.
We loved the way the cruise staff incorporated storytelling and guided tours, making the experience more than just a walk through a cave. The walk up to the cave involves steep stone steps under lush foliage, offering a mini-hike that rewards you with panoramic views at the entrance. It’s a good idea to wear comfortable shoes for this part.
Later, the boat anchors near Trinh Nu Beach, a quiet spot perfect for unwinding after the caves. This area includes Trinh Nu Cave and a private beach where you can kayak in the crystal-clear waters—a favorite activity among past travelers. One reviewer mentioned how peaceful and raw this part of the trip felt, emphasizing the chance to connect with nature away from crowds.
As the day winds down, the cruise transitions into a lively evening. Guests participate in a Sunset Party and Vietnamese cooking class, where you learn to make Fried Spring Rolls. The sunset views from the deck are described as stunning, with many noting the peaceful ambiance. Happy hour offers a chance to sip drinks and socialize, adding to the convivial atmosphere.
The outdoor dinner, weather permitting, allows you to dine under the stars while soaking in the bay’s tranquility. Evening activities include a herbal foot bath and optional massages—additional charges—plus entertainment like traditional costume shows and squid fishing. Past travelers mention how these activities add a personal touch, making the experience feel intimate and authentic.

Starting early with Tai Chi on the deck, you get a peaceful start to the day. The light breakfast offers a variety of options, including Vietnamese Pho and fresh fruits, ensuring you’re energized for the day ahead.
The highlight of the morning is a visit to Titop Island. Here, you can hike to the top for sweeping views of Halong Bay, or opt for a swim in the inviting waters. Reviewers frequently praise this part for its breathtaking scenery and the chance to stretch your legs after a day on the boat.
Back on the cruise, there’s time to relax, sunbathe, and take photos of the bay’s stunning limestone formations. The end of the trip involves a check-out process, and you’ll be transferred back to Tuan Chau Marina, with an optional bike ride around the island for those on group packages.
At a price of $310 per person, this cruise offers a comprehensive experience. It includes all major sightseeing tickets, meals, activities like kayaking and cooking, and comfortable accommodations. Is transportation from Hanoi included?
Yes, the tour offers pickup from your hotel in Hanoi’s Old Quarter, with transfers organized to Tuan Chau Island, making the journey seamless.
How long is the cruise each day?
Day one includes about 5 hours of activities and cruising, while day two offers around 4 hours, including visits to Titop Island and breakfast.
Are meals included?
Yes, the package includes four meals over the two days: breakfast, lunch, dinner, and an outdoor dinner (weather permitting).
Can dietary restrictions be accommodated?
Absolutely. The tour can cater to vegetarian, vegan, gluten-free, and other dietary needs if specified while booking.
What activities are included?
Activities include kayaking, visiting Sung Sot Cave, hiking at Titop Island, swimming, a Vietnamese cooking class, and cultural shows.
Is WiFi available onboard?
Yes, WiFi is available during the cruise, but connectivity may be limited during certain activities or in remote parts of the bay.
What is the group size?
The tour accommodates up to 25 travelers, ensuring a more intimate and personalized experience.
